Output 89fa5203aafe109eef70a23a7e1da587c3ef1c0a66f614f74d12ac54b2577499:1

value
19602798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edd05dc74c9e7c7fe32a4940f6fe2ae314420df7 OP_EQUAL
address
MVabzSU1buZGLM8V1ys2mua2adWhoEEtkF
transaction
89fa5203aafe109eef70a23a7e1da587c3ef1c0a66f614f74d12ac54b2577499
spent
true